I allways use Norton on my XP and 98 machines, but like all regcleaners you can't let them do an automatic repair, because these progs want restore shortcuts and other files from the trash bin. Some progs want to delete empty uninstall-strings. Why? In many cases the programmer has placed these strings as a flag! And why want they delete the shortcuts? After an hour they are back! Happily you can make an ignore-list. I hate Registry Mechanic, it corrupted my scanreg.exe. Agrith |
